When vendors work together it can exponentially simplify IT’s job.

Some may see the latest FlexPod from Netapp as another arrow in their quiver and the next generation of a solution that supports Microsoft System Center 2012. It is, but I see something way more interesting. It is difficult in any partnership to get two teams to work collaboratively, share a common vision and strategy, and successfully execute together. NetApp’s latest announcement includes the collaboration and cooperation of FOUR vendors – FOUR! This is not an easy feat.

NetApp, Citrix, Cisco, and Microsoft

IT organizations are ultimately always left to do the integration, testing, validations, and, truthfully, guesswork. When vendors work together it can exponentially simplify IT’s job.
